mirror of
https://gitlab.freedesktop.org/pipewire/pipewire.git
synced 2025-11-02 09:01:50 -05:00
Add logger
Add logger interface Make it possible to pass extra interfaces to the element at init time, such as a logger.
This commit is contained in:
parent
e90c53e48d
commit
49dae17dfb
26 changed files with 251 additions and 47 deletions
|
|
@ -138,7 +138,7 @@ loop (void *user_data)
|
|||
for (i = 0; i < priv->n_poll; i++) {
|
||||
SpaPollItem *p = &priv->poll[i];
|
||||
|
||||
if (p->enabled && p->after_cb) {
|
||||
if (p->enabled && p->after_cb && (p->n_fds == 0 || priv->fds[priv->idx[i]].revents != 0)) {
|
||||
ndata.fds = &priv->fds[priv->idx[i]];
|
||||
ndata.n_fds = p->n_fds;
|
||||
ndata.user_data = p->user_data;
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ue